dialectic patterns, hybridization, representation, the temptations of embers and rubies, Abdul Hamid ShakilAbstract
The poetic writing in The Seduction of Embers and Rubies by Abdelhamid Shakil draws its material from the Sufi experience, because it operates on a space furnished with spirituality. This study therefore aims to monitor the cultural patterns formed for the spectra of meaning, in the diwan of "The Temptations of Embers and Rubies" by AbdelhamidShakil, and follow the formations of textual imagination, which appear and disappear, according to the dialectic of presence and absence, to interact through an overlapping network, with realistic and apocalyptic spaces, in the light of dual patterns and imagination
